Our Hydrocyclone Filters are primary filtration units used in irrigation systems to remove heavy sand, grit, and large suspended particles from water through centrifugal separation. These filters protect downstream filtration equipment and irrigation networks from abrasion and clogging.
In irrigation systems using borewell, canal, or open water sources, heavy particles can cause severe wear and blockages. Khedut Irrigation addresses this challenge by manufacturing Hydrocyclone Filters with robust, corrosion-resistant construction and optimized internal geometry. By efficiently separating heavier particles before they enter the system, these filters improve overall filtration efficiency and extend system life.
